To comprehend the significance of a Level 2 Electrician, one must first value the hierarchical structure of the electrical market. While a general electrician might wire a brand-new home or troubleshoot internal faults, their purview normally ends at the point of connection to the main supply. This is precisely where the Level 2 expert steps in. They are authorised and certified to deal with the service lines that bring power from the street pole or underground network directly to the facilities. This important user interface demands an unique mix of proficiency, strenuous training, and a steady commitment to safety.

The responsibilities of a Level 2 Electrician vary and demanding. They are the ones you call when your power has actually been disconnected, whether due to an overdue costs or an emergency situation. They manage brand-new service connections for residential and business properties, making sure the seamless integration of a brand-new develop into the existing power facilities. Upgrading service capabilities for homes with increased power needs, such as those setting up air conditioning systems or electric automobile chargers, also falls squarely within their domain. Furthermore, they are adept at repairing and changing overhead and underground service cable televisions, a task that frequently includes working in tough conditions and at significant heights. Fault finding on the network side of the meter, an intricate diagnostic procedure that can quickly bring back power to an afflicted home, is another important service they supply.

The journey to becoming a Level 2 Electrician is an arduous one, reflecting the gravity of their responsibilities. It normally starts with a fundamental electrical apprenticeship, leading to a certified electrician certification. This preliminary phase supplies the broad understanding of electrical theory, wiring practices, and security protocols. However, the path does not end there. To certify as a Level 2, an electrician should undertake more here specialised training and accreditation, typically through industry-recognised programs. This advanced education covers particular policies referring to service lines, metering treatments, network security standards, and the complexities of working survive on electrical assets. Each state and area has its own specific licensing requirements and classes for Level 2 accreditation, guaranteeing a consistent standard of competence across the country.

Beyond technical efficiency, a Level 2 Electrician need to possess an intense understanding of security. Operating in distance to live mains power carries inherent threats, and adherence to strict safety protocols is paramount. This includes precise risk evaluations, the correct use of personal protective equipment (PPE), and an undeviating dedication to safe work practices. They are often working in public areas, needing an eager awareness of their surroundings and the security of the public. Their work can be physically requiring, involving climbing up poles, digging trenches, and working outdoors in all climate condition.
